Understanding Change Order Management

change order management blog header

Change order management in complex industries like maritime, aviation, aerospace, and government contracting is the process of systematically handling modifications to a project’s original plan, contract, or scope. It involves capturing, reviewing, approving, documenting, and integrating changes while ensuring compliance, cost control, and minimal disruption to project timelines.

What is Change Order Management

Change order management refers to controlling alterations to contract terms, project scope, material specifications, schedules, or costs after the original project commencement. These can arise from unforeseen site conditions, regulatory changes, design modifications, or evolving client requirements. Timely and accurate handling ensures projects remain aligned with objectives while managing risks associated with scope creep, budget overruns, and delays.

Challenges in Change Order Management in Complex Industries

Industries like maritime, aviation, aerospace, and government contracting face unique complexities:

  • Highly regulated environments with strict compliance standards (NIST, CMMC, ITAR) demand thorough documentation and audit trails.
  • Multi-party supply chains and subcontractor involvement increase coordination and communication complexity.
  • Technical intricacies and long project durations require detailed impact assessments and cost management.
  • Resistance to digitization can limit the adoption of modern change management tools in traditionally manual or spreadsheet-driven workflows.
  • Maintaining version control and safeguarding sensitive data are critical due to project scale and confidentiality.

Best Practices for Effective Change Order Management

In highly complex projects, whether in maritime refit, aviation MRO, aerospace manufacture or government contracting, change orders are a frequent and often inevitable part of execution. What separates successfully managed projects from the ones that spiral in cost or schedule is not the avoidance of change, but the discipline and rigor with which change orders are handled. Establishing and applying best-practice change order management becomes the linchpin of maintaining control over scope, budget, time and quality.

  • Define a clear baseline and contract schedule / scope: At the outset, ensure the contract, scope, schedule and cost baseline are well defined, and that change control procedures are established (roles, responsibilities, forms, approval process).
  • Establish a change-order process: Standardize the workflow: change request → analysis → cost/time estimate → approval → documentation → integration → audit/log.
  • Capture and quantify impact quickly: Use standard unit costs, rate cards, and history from past work to accelerate estimation of changes. As soon as a request is raised, document cost/time impact before work proceeds.
  • Secure upfront approval before work begins: To avoid disputes and unforeseen cost absorption, get formal sign-off on cost and schedule implications before executing the change.
  • Maintain a change order log and audit trail: Track all change orders, their status, cost/time impact, origin, approval date, attachments, and link them to project schedules and budgets.
  • Integrate with cost/schedule systems: Ensure the change order feeds into your schedule (impacting tasks, milestones), cost system (budget, actuals), margins, and contract value.
  • Communicate clearly with stakeholders: Document what changed (scope/specification), why the change is required, what the cost/time impact is, and how the project baseline shifts.
